Option 4 miCoach Manager does not start automatically?

0
0

1. You can start the miCoach Manager manually as follows: Start -> All programs -> adidas -> miCoach manager 2. Check if you have downloaded the appropriate version of miCoach Manager for your Windows machine (see above). If you do not know whether you are running a 32-bit or 64-bit version of Windows, check the Microsoft webpage: http://support.microsoft.com/kb/827218 3. Check the system requirements for miCoach Manager: Hardware / Machine Processor speed: 600MHz or faster Disk Space: 100MB of free hard disk space RAM: 256MB USB Port: 1.1 or 2 Web Browsers Microsoft Internet Explorer 6.0 or later Firefox 2.x or later Safari 3.x or later Chrome 5.x or later Operating Systems Microsoft Windows XP (SP2 or later) Microsoft Windows Vista Java Runtime Environment (JRE) 1.5 or later 4. Make sure you have the latest version of Java installed as it is required for the Manager to run: http://www.java.com/en/download/manual.jsp 5. Do you use a firewall?
